Capture TCP and UDP traffic
Description
Add native support for capturing and inspecting raw TCP and UDP traffic in Proxyman, as an optional “Socket Capture” mode. This would present all TCP and UDP packets in the familiar Proxyman UI, with process-based grouping, live filtering, and protocol-specific inspectors.
Why this feature/change is important?
This would be game-changing for a lot of people, it would provide a one-stop diagnostic tool for both high and low-level network analysis. Today, developers must juggle Proxyman for HTTP/S and Wireshark (or tcpdump) for TCP/UDP, each with different UIs, steep learning curves, and no seamless hand-off. Proxyman’s per-app traffic separation extended to TCP/UDP means you can instantly correlate, say, an IoT device’s MQTT packets or a game’s UDP voice-chat with the originating app, without deciphering random port numbers.
@ivansavra1 thanks for opening this ticket, we might implement it when have more similar requests 👍
+1 🙌 @NghiaTranUIT
@lee1409 what do you want to inspect the TCP/UDP? Do you want to inspect the raw package? Or anything else?
Hi @NghiaTranUIT , for this case, it’d be helpful to have TCP/UDP inspection with a Protobuf serializer/deserializer.
I'm also looking for this feature. Trying to abandon fiddler in favor of proxyman but would like it to have parity with its low network debugging capability specially this one https://docs.telerik.com/fiddler-everywhere/capture-traffic/capture-network-traffic